S

Steven Desmet

1 year ago

⚡️ Nanovoltaics, Inc. is a great company in the re...

⚡️ Nanovoltaics, Inc. is a great company in the renewable energy sector. Their solar panels are top-notch and perform exceptionally well. The team at Nanovoltaics is dedicated and provides excellent customer support. I highly recommend their products!

Comments:

No comments